Opossums very rarely get rabies, and the risk to humans is extremely low. This is largely because their unusually low body temperature—in the range of about 94 to 97°F (34–36°C)—is less suitable for the rabies virus compared with many other mammals. When people worry about opossums and rabies, they are often reacting to the animal’s scavenging habits and fearsome hissing display, but verified data show they are among the least likely species to carry and transmit rabies. How Rabies Transmission Works
Rabies is a viral disease that spreads through the saliva of an infected animal, most commonly via bites. The virus travels from the site of the bite along nerves to the brain and central nervous system. For rabies to establish and then be present in saliva, the virus must replicate in nervous tissue and reach the salivary glands. The course of infection typically progresses through stages, including a prodromal phase, a furious phase, and finally a paralytic phase. Transmission is most likely when infectious saliva from a rabid animal comes into contact with fresh bites or mucous membranes. Because opossums seldom bite and have a low viral-shedding profile even under experimental conditions, they play a minor role in rabies transmission cycles.

Opossum Biology and Body Temperature
The Virginia opossum (Didelphis virginiana) has several physiological traits that lower its rabies risk. One of the most important is a relatively low and stable body temperature, typically between about 94 and 97°F (34–36°C). This is notably cooler than many other wild mammals, such as raccoons, skunks, or foxes. Because the rabies virus replicates more efficiently at or near typical mammalian body temperatures—around 98–104°F (37–40°C)—the opossum’s cooler physiology can limit viral growth and shedding. In practical terms, even if an opossum is exposed to rabies, the odds that the virus will establish a sufficient infection and reach transmissible levels are lower than in species with warmer bodies.

Rabies Risk: Opossums Compared With Other Wildlife
From a public health perspective, rabies risk is often discussed in terms of which species are most frequently found rabid and which are most likely to transmit the virus to people and pets. In the United States, the primary wildlife reservoirs for rabies vary by region and include bats, raccoons, skunks, foxes, and, in some areas, coyotes. Opossums appear near the bottom of this list in national surveillance data. Their scavenging behavior and tendency to scavenge carrion can create the impression that they are high risk, but verified surveillance indicates otherwise. Recognizing Rabies-Like Signs in Opossums
Although rare, any wild animal acting strangely should be treated with caution. Rabies can cause behavioral changes such as increased activity during daylight, unprovoked aggression, difficulty walking, excessive drooling, or apparent tameness. However, opossums are naturally nocturnal and may be active at night without being rabid. They are also known to "play possum," a drastic involuntary response that can include appearing weak, limp, or unresponsive, which is often confused with illness. Because of this, it is important not to interpret normal opossum behaviors as signs of rabies. If you observe a truly abnormal, aggressive, or clearly disoriented opossum—especially one that is active in broad daylight and shows neurological signs—contact local animal control or public health authorities rather than approaching it.

Preventive Measures Around Opossums
Preventing rabies exposure begins with managing attractants and securing your property. While opossums are not the primary rabies concern, reducing potential encounters is a sensible step. Secure garbage in tight-fitting containers, avoid leaving pet food outdoors overnight, and keep poultry and livestock secured. Seal gaps under sheds and decks to reduce denning opportunities. Vaccinate cats and dogs against rabies as required by law and recommended for any pets with outdoor access. These steps lower the chance of wildlife interactions and ensure domestic animals are protected even if exposure is rare.

What to Do If Bitten or Exposed
Rabies post-exposure prophylaxis (PEP) is highly effective when administered promptly, but it is only used when there is a credible risk of rabies transmission. If you are bitten or otherwise exposed to the saliva of a potentially rabid animal, wash the wound immediately with soap and water for at least 15 minutes. Seek medical attention right away to assess whether PEP is warranted. Public health officials can help determine risk based on the animal species, the circumstances of the exposure, and local rabies surveillance. For opossums, the likelihood that PEP is needed is very low, but any potential exposure should be evaluated by a healthcare provider or local health department.
